November 9, 2023

Statement on Settlement of Sisters of Life Pregnancy Center Litigation

In a settlement of a federal lawsuit, Sisters of Life v. McDonald, New York State has agreed to a court order protecting the Sisters from government intrusion into their religious ministry as part of a “pregnancy center study” law passed by the legislature and signed by Governor Hochul in 2022.
